PackageDescriptionMolecular dynamics sim, binaries for MPICH parallelization GROMACS is a versatile package to perform molecular dynamics, i.e. simulate the Newtonian equations of motion for systems with hundreds to millions of particles. . It is primarily designed for biochemical molecules like proteins and lipids that have a lot of complicated bonded interactions, but since GROMACS is extremely fast at calculating the nonbonded interactions (that usually dominate simulations) many groups are also using it for research on non- biological systems, e.g. polymers. . This package contains only the core simulation engine with parallel support using the MPICH (v3) interface. It is suitable for nodes of a processing cluster, or for multiprocessor machines.
